New Albany Elementary School serves 655 students in grades Kindergarten-2.
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is equal to the New Jersey state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 27%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New Jersey state average of 62% (majority Hispanic).

New Albany Elementary School's student population of 655 students has grown by 14% over five school years.
The teacher population of 57 teachers has grown by 50% over five school years.
